1. Choosing the Right Engine
When it comes to fuel efficiency on your boat, one of the most important factors to consider is choosing the right engine. There are various options available, but two of the most common choices are gasoline and diesel engines.
1.1 Gasoline vs. Diesel Engines
Gasoline engines are popular among boaters for their affordability and ease of maintenance. They are generally lighter and offer a higher power-to-weight ratio compared to diesel engines. However, they tend to be less fuel-efficient and may require more frequent refueling.
On the other hand, diesel engines are known for their excellent fuel efficiency and durability. While they may be more expensive upfront, they can save you money in the long run with their lower fuel consumption. Diesel engines are also more reliable and have a longer lifespan than gasoline engines.
1.2 Consider Horsepower and Weight
When choosing an engine, it’s essential to consider the horsepower and weight of your boat. The engine should be powerful enough to propel your boat efficiently without any struggle, but not excessively powerful, as this can lead to unnecessary fuel consumption.
Additionally, the weight of the engine itself is another crucial factor to consider. A lighter engine can help reduce the overall weight of the boat, leading to improved fuel efficiency.
1.3 Assess Engine Efficiency
Apart from the type of engine and its power, it’s vital to assess the overall efficiency of the engine. Look for engines that have a good thermal efficiency rating, as this indicates how effectively the engine converts fuel into useful work. Engines with higher thermal efficiency will consume less fuel for the same amount of power output.

2. Proper Propeller Selection
The propeller you choose for your boat can significantly impact fuel efficiency. It’s important to understand propeller size, pitch, and match it correctly with your engine.
2.1 Understanding Propeller Size and Pitch
Propeller size refers to the diameter of the propeller. Larger propellers can move more water with each rotation, providing greater thrust and potentially improving fuel efficiency. However, it’s essential to ensure that the propeller is not too large for your boat, as this can put unnecessary strain on the engine.
Propeller pitch refers to the distance the propeller moves forward in one complete revolution. Higher pitch propellers can achieve greater speeds, but they may also cause the engine to work harder and consume more fuel. Consider your boat’s weight, desired speed, and cruising conditions when selecting the pitch.
2.2 Match Propeller to Engine
Matching the propeller to the engine is crucial for optimal performance and fuel efficiency. Consult the engine manufacturer’s recommendations for suitable propellers that match the engine’s specifications. Using an ill-suited propeller can lead to increased fuel consumption and reduce overall efficiency.
2.3 Consider Different Propeller Types
There are various propeller types available, such as fixed, folding, and feathering propellers. Each type has its own advantages and considerations regarding fuel efficiency.
Fixed propellers are the most common and economical option. They are designed to provide consistent performance but may not perform as well at low speeds. Folding and feathering propellers are more expensive but offer better fuel efficiency at lower speeds. Consider your boating needs and budget when deciding on the propeller type.
3. Optimizing Trim and Planning
Proper trim and planning can significantly impact your boat’s fuel efficiency. Understanding trim, adjusting it for fuel efficiency, and planning your trips ahead can make a noticeable difference in your fuel consumption.
3.1 Understanding Trim
Trim refers to the angle of the boat’s bow in relation to the water’s surface. It affects how the boat moves through the water and can impact fuel efficiency. A boat that is properly trimmed will have reduced resistance and better hydrodynamics, resulting in improved fuel economy.
3.2 Adjusting Trim for Fuel Efficiency
To optimize fuel efficiency, adjust the boat’s trim to find the sweet spot where the boat glides smoothly through the water. Experiment with different trim angles to find the setting that minimizes drag and maximizes fuel economy. Small adjustments can make a significant impact on your overall fuel consumption.
3.3 Plan Ahead to Avoid Wasted Fuel
Proper planning and navigation can help you avoid wasting fuel on unnecessary detours or inefficient routes. Use charts, maps, and navigation tools to plan your trips and choose the most direct and fuel-efficient routes. Avoid areas with strong currents or headwinds that can increase fuel consumption. By planning ahead, you can save both time and fuel.
4. Efficient Cruising Speed
Finding the optimal cruising speed is essential for fuel efficiency. By understanding the factors that influence the cruise speed, you can make informed decisions to improve fuel economy.
4.1 Find the Sweet Spot
Every boat has a “sweet spot” where it operates most efficiently. This is the speed that allows your boat to achieve maximum fuel economy for a given engine and hull combination. Experiment with different speeds and monitor your fuel consumption to identify the optimal cruising speed for your boat.
4.2 Consider Currents and Tides
When determining your cruising speed, take into account the effect of currents and tides. Utilize favorable currents to your advantage by adjusting your speed accordingly. Avoid fighting against strong currents, as this can significantly increase fuel consumption. Plan your trips to take advantage of tidal flows and optimize your fuel efficiency.

5. Minimizing Resistance and Drag
Reducing resistance and drag can lead to improved fuel efficiency on your boat. By following these practices, you can minimize the energy required to move through the water.
5.1 Keep the Hull Clean
A clean hull is essential for reducing resistance. Regularly clean your boat’s hull to remove any marine growth, algae, or barnacles that can increase drag. Smooth surfaces provide better hydrodynamics, allowing the boat to move through the water more effortlessly and consume less fuel.
5.2 Reduce Parasitic Drag
Parasitic drag refers to drag caused by factors other than the boat’s shape, such as through-hull openings, struts, or appendages. Minimize parasitic drag by ensuring all through-hull fittings are properly sealed, struts are aligned correctly, and any unnecessary appendages are removed. This reduction in drag can significantly improve fuel efficiency.
5.3 Optimize Weight Distribution
Proper weight distribution can help reduce resistance and improve fuel efficiency. Avoid overloading your boat with unnecessary gear or items. Ensure heavy items are evenly distributed to maintain stability and avoid creating unnecessary drag. By optimizing weight distribution, you can enhance your boat’s performance and save fuel.

7. Fuel Management and Monitoring
Proper fuel management and monitoring are vital for maximizing fuel efficiency on your boat. By implementing these practices, you can optimize your fuel usage and track your consumption.
7.1 Proper Fuel Tank Maintenance
Regularly check and maintain your boat’s fuel tank to ensure it is clean and free from contaminants. Water or debris in the tank can affect fuel quality and potentially increase fuel consumption. Follow proper fuel tank maintenance procedures, such as draining any accumulated water and using fuel additives when necessary, to optimize fuel efficiency.
7.2 Invest in Fuel Monitoring Systems
Investing in a fuel monitoring system can provide valuable insights into your fuel consumption and efficiency. These systems track fuel levels, consumption rates, and other relevant data, allowing you to make informed decisions to optimize fuel usage. By closely monitoring fuel consumption, you can identify any potential issues or areas for improvement.
7.3 Track Fuel Consumption and Efficiency
Keep a record of your fuel consumption and efficiency over time. This can be as simple as logging fuel purchases and tracking the distance traveled or investing in more advanced systems that provide detailed reports. By analyzing your fuel consumption patterns, you can identify any changes or trends and implement adjustments to improve fuel efficiency.

9. Mindful Maintenance and Repairs
Regular maintenance and prompt repairs are essential for maximizing fuel efficiency on your boat. Follow these practices to ensure your boat is in optimal condition.
9.1 Regularly Service the Engine
Schedule regular engine maintenance to keep it running efficiently. Follow the manufacturer’s recommended service intervals for oil changes, filter replacements, and other maintenance tasks. A well-maintained engine operates more efficiently and consumes less fuel. Additionally, promptly address any engine issues to avoid further fuel consumption.
9.2 Check and Replace Filters
Keep a close eye on your boat’s fuel and air filters. Dirty or clogged filters can restrict fuel flow and air intake, leading to decreased engine performance and increased fuel consumption. Regularly inspect and clean or replace filters as needed to ensure uninterrupted fuel flow and efficient engine operation.
9.3 Preventive Measures for Fuel System
Take preventive measures to maintain your boat’s fuel system in optimal condition. Regularly inspect fuel lines, fittings, and connections for any signs of leaks or damage. Ensure the fuel tank vent is clear and functioning correctly to prevent any vacuum or pressure issues. By addressing fuel system maintenance proactively, you can avoid potential fuel efficiency problems.
